This document provides a summary of a presentation on cloud security at Netflix. It discusses Netflix's cloud security architecture from past to present to future. It emphasizes that Netflix adopts cloud-native principles like agility, decentralization, and self-service for security development. It addresses common concerns about trusting the cloud and special requirements. It outlines Netflix's perspective on balancing security and flexibility. Finally, it discusses Netflix's approach to key management and how it has evolved from storing keys in properties files to using temporary credentials from AWS Identity and Access Management.
